    Exclamation Champion sleeve logo back in 1983

    Although the NFL era of sleeve manuufacturer logos commenced circa 1989-90, Champion (who occasionally affixed the logos on NFL attire before that) actually began the practice with their USFL uniforms as far back as 1983.

    Pictured below is a 1983 Chicago Blitz Greg Landry jersey from the back. Note the small logo on the bottom of the left sleeve. That appears to be the beginning of the practice for pro football.
